一、 准备工作:文件与路径规范
必备文件清单
• 服务端:即 MirServer 文件夹,需包含 DBServer、Mir200、Mud2 等核心目录。
- 客户端:热血传奇客户端(建议使用十三周年或十六周年纯净版)。
• 数据库:DBC2000(32位/64位根据系统选择)。
- 登录器:与服务端引擎配套的登录器生成器(如GOM引擎需用GOM配置器)。
路径硬性要求
• 服务端必须解压到 D盘根目录,路径为 D:\MirServer。部分引擎对路径极其敏感,非D盘会导致启动失败。
- 客户端路径严禁包含中文或空格,建议直接放在磁盘根目录(如 D:\热血传奇)。
二、 第一步:安装与配置DBC2000数据库
安装软件
运行 DBC2000 安装包,一直点击“Next”直到完成,安装路径默认即可。安装后无需打开软件桌面图标。
配置数据库别名
1. 打开电脑控制面板,将查看方式改为“大图标”,找到 BDE Administrator 并打开。
2. 点击菜单栏 Object → New,选择 STANDARD,点击OK。
3. 将左侧 STANDARD1 重命名为 HeroDB(必须大写)。
4. 在右侧 PATH 栏点击 ...,选择路径 D:\MirServer\Mud2\DB。
5. 点击 Apply 保存,关闭窗口时选择“Yes”。
关键点:HeroDB 是引擎默认读取的数据库别名,路径必须指向服务端的 DB 文件夹,否则启动时会报“数据库连接失败”。
三、 第二步:配置引擎与启动服务端
运行引擎控制器
进入 D:\MirServer,找到 GameCenter.exe(GOM/GEE引擎)或 引擎控制器.exe,双击打开。
设置向导
1. 服务端目录:自动识别为 D:\MirServer,若不对需手动修正。
2. 数据库名称:填写 HeroDB,与BDE中设置的别名保持一致。
3. 服务器IP:单机架设必须填写 127.0.0.1,不要勾选“动态IP”。
4. 服务器名称:自定义区名(如“单机测试区”)。
点击“下一步”直至“保存”,返回主界面点击“启动游戏服务器”。等待所有网关(如LoginGate、RunGate)显示“已启动”或“Ready”状态,表示服务端运行成功。
四、 第三步:配置登录器与补丁
生成登录器
1. 打开服务端内的“登录器”文件夹,运行 MakeGameLogin.exe(登录器生成器)。
2. 列表地址:单机可使用本地列表(如 127.0.0.1/list.txt)或上传到免费列表空间获取URL。
3. 客户端搜索:勾选“自动搜索客户端”,或手动指定客户端路径。
4. 点击“生成登录器”,将生成的 .exe 文件放入客户端根目录。
打入补丁
将服务端压缩包内的“补丁”文件夹(通常包含 Data、Map 等子文件夹),整体解压到客户端根目录。切勿只解压补丁内的文件,必须保留文件夹结构,否则会出现黑屏、装备不显示。
五、 常见启动故障排查
报错现象 原因分析 解决方案
启动引擎报“数据库连接失败” DBC路径错误或未Apply 检查BDE中HeroDB的PATH是否为 D:\MirServer\Mud2\DB
登录器显示“无法连接服务器” 网关未启动或IP错误 确认引擎所有网关已启动,IP为127.0.0.1
游戏内地图黑屏、装备透明 补丁路径错误 确认补丁文件夹在客户端根目录,且名称与登录器配置一致
启动时提示“端口被占用” 重复启动或残留进程 关闭所有传奇相关程序,重启电脑或更换端口
最后步骤:双击客户端内的登录器,选择单机测试区,创建角色即可进入游戏。若需外网联机,需将IP改为公网IP并配置路由器端口转发。

